Computerized method and system for teaching prose, document and quantitative literacy

1. A method for teaching literacy skills comprising computerized multimedia instruction means, said method comprising:

  • (a) providing literacy instruction for identifying the structures of printed material;

    (b) providing literacy instruction for understanding the structures of printed material;

    (c) providing literacy instruction for understanding the uses of printed material;

    (d) providing literacy instruction for applying strategies for locating and for processing information from printed material; and

    (e) selecting at least one of said literacy instructions and providing exercises and questions relating to said at least one of said literacy instructions.
